[T]he word “marxism” contains an implicit negation of Marx’s basic tenet that individuals are unimportant; from which it follows that, having been individuals, Marx and Lenin are unimportant – and therefore those who accept the collectivist view of social causation should forget about them.
— Stanislav Andreski, Social Sciences as Sorcery (New York: St. Martins Press, 1973), p. 185
